Nimrod Foster 1754–1818 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 2 March 1754

Birth Location: Prince William County, Virginia, United States of America

Death Date: 13 June 1818

Death Location: Keslers Cross Lanes, Nicholas County, West Virginia, United States of America

Father: Isaac Foster

Mother: Sarah Hughes

Spouse(s): Elizabeth Brown

Children(s): Elizabeth Foster

In 1754, Nimrod Foster entered the world in Prince William County, Virginia, United States of America, born to Isaac Foster And Sarah Ann Hughes. Nimrod Foster married Elizabeth Winnie Brown, and had children including Elizabeth Betsy Foster. Nimrod Foster passed away in 1818 in Keslers Cross Lanes, Nicholas County, West Virginia, United States of America.
